[MOD][UI] Rollover Ally Info v1.4.2

(The above image is of v1.3)

(The above image is of v1.4)

Features:
- Adds a mana display to a unit's rollover information if they have mana.
- Adds a display of gold for a friendly unit.
- Adds a display of a friendly demigod's equipment.
- Adds a display of a friendly demigod's consumables.
- Adds a display of a friendly demigod's favour item.
- Adds a display of a friendly demigod's buffs and debuffs.
- Will not display the popup for yourself.

Notes:
This is a User-Interface mod, so it doesn't require anyone else to have it installed.

How to Install:
Extract the folder into the Mods directory for Demigod.
eg. C:\Program Files (x86)\Stardock Games\Demigod\bindata\mods

How to Enable:
Inside Demigod, and under the Mod Manager, simply enable the mod!

If you have problems, make sure that your directory setup is akin to:
C:\Program Files (x86)\Stardock Games\Demigod\bindata\mods\Rollover Ally Info\mod_info.lua

Files modified (for mod conflict checking only):
lua\ui\game\HUD_rollover.lua
